Ingredientes para Thai Swordfish Wraps
- Brown Sugar
- Whole Coriander Seeds
- Whole Black Peppercorn
- Mustard Seeds
- Celery Seed
- Swordfish Fillets
- Olive Oil
- Salt
- Boston Lettuce
- Vermicelli
- Fresh Cilantro
- Carrot
- Bean Sprouts
- Lime Wedge
- Fresh Basil
- Cucumber
- Sugar
- Water
- Rice
- Garlic
- Kosher Salt
- Fresh Lime Juice
- Fish Sauce
- Red Pepper Flakes

Como fazer Thai Swordfish Wraps
- In a small bowl, combine all spice rub ingredients. Rub the mixture evenly onto the swordfish steaks.
- Heat olive oil in a grill pan or on a grill over medium-high heat.
- Grill the swordfish for 3-4 minutes per side, or until cooked through. The internal temperature should reach 145°F (63°C).
- While the swordfish is grilling, prepare the dipping sauce by whisking together all ingredients in a small bowl. Adjust seasoning to taste.
- In a separate bowl, combine the shredded vegetables and herbs.
- Once the swordfish is cooked, let it rest for a few minutes before slicing it into bite-sized pieces.
- To assemble the wraps, place a portion of the vegetable mixture in each lettuce leaf, top with sliced swordfish, and drizzle with the dipping sauce.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
